St. Augustine Pickleball Team Suspended from Competition Due to Head Coach’s Drug-Related Difficulties
In a shocking development, the St. Augustine Pickleball team has been temporarily suspended from the competition they participate in, following a series of drug-related issues involving their head coach. The suspension has rocked the local sports community and raised serious concerns regarding the integrity of the team, the responsibilities of coaches, and the impact of personal issues on professional athletes.
The Drug-Related Incident and Allegations
The controversy surrounding the St. Augustine Pickleball team began when reports surfaced about the head coach’s involvement in drug-related difficulties. According to multiple sources, the coach, whose name has not been publicly disclosed due to privacy concerns, was found to be in violation of the league’s policies regarding drug use. While the specifics of the allegations are still being investigated, it is believed that the coach had been using performance-enhancing substances or illicit drugs, which led to his suspension from the team and the team’s subsequent disqualification from competition.
The coach’s actions were not only a violation of league rules but also created significant tensions within the team. Several players are said to have been unaware of the coach’s struggles, and the revelation of the drug-related issues has left many stunned and disappointed. The coach’s behavior is said to have affected the team’s performance and morale, with some players expressing concerns about the ethical implications of their coach’s actions.
Official Response from the Pickleball League
Following the investigation into the allegations, the governing body of the pickleball league in which St. Augustine competes made the decision to suspend the team from the ongoing competition. In an official statement, the league emphasized that the suspension was necessary to uphold the integrity of the sport and to protect the safety and well-being of all participants.
“The suspension of the St. Augustine Pickleball team was a difficult but necessary decision,” the statement read. “We have a zero-tolerance policy when it comes to drug use and unethical behavior. The actions of the head coach violated our code of conduct, and as a result, the team will be temporarily suspended from all competition while we continue to review the matter.”
The suspension means that the St. Augustine Pickleball team will be unable to participate in the remainder of the season’s competitions. This has left both the players and fans of the team disappointed and uncertain about the future. For the time being, the team is prohibited from playing in any league-sanctioned events, and the head coach remains under investigation.
